Roasted Chicken-And-White Bean Pizzas
- 1 (15.8-ounce) can Great Northern beans, drained
- 1 teaspoon lemon juice
- 1/8 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/8 teaspoon pepper
- 1 (1/2-pound) package ready-to-eat roasted boneless, skinless chicken breast halves, chopped
- 1/4 teaspoon dried rosemary, crushed
- 1 (12-ounce) package of 3 (7-inch) pizza crusts (such as Mama Mary's)
- 1 cup thinly sliced fresh spinach
- 3/4 cup (3 ounces) shredded sharp provolone
- Preheat oven to 450u0b0.
- Place first 4 ingredients in a blender or food processor, and process until smooth. Set aside.
- Combine chicken and rosemary in a large bowl, and toss well. Spread 1/3 cup bean mixture evenly over each crust, leaving a 1/4-inch border. Top each crust with 1/2 cup chicken, 1/3 cup spinach, and 1/4 cup cheese.
- Place pizzas directly on oven rack, and bake at 450u0b0 for 8 minutes or until crusts are golden.
